Saw it today and for me.....meh

The bad:

The first 30 minutes were absolutely painful. It felt like everything was forced and there was zero flow. The movie starts off like it knows we're aware of the story, (ex. showing the no-name thief getting killed while the opening music is still be played) and quickly showing every character.

Then randomly jump to Jasmine already being in the street and that being the first time we see her. Why would you start the film off implying that you're aware that we know the story and then completely skip an entire scene we're familiar with and expecting where we're first introduced to Jasmine and her father, her frustrations with being courted, and never leaving the palace? And then have Jasmine be a part of the street chase?

There was one moment through all this I seriously thought our film had screwed up and left a scene out it felt so thrown together.

And Jafar was...just...awful. I mean...wow. I never took this guy serious when he was on screen. A few moments had me chuckling when he was trying to be intimidating......part of the problem though is that they were forced in this film to have Jafar interact with other characters in scenes he normally wouldn't have....why? Cause no talking bird! So much of his dialogue and scheming in the original was done interacting with Iago...but since this film was apparently trying to be more "realistic" (while still keeping a flying rug that can convey emotion) they barely use Iago's his name and make him a somewhat repeating forgetful bird....

The good:

The actors for Aladdin and Jasmine definitely looked the part. Their chemistry at the beginning still felt forced and unnatural, but if you were to shut your eyes and imagine what these characters would look like as real people this would be it.

The music? Great! Other than the bad street chase I already mentioned I thought all the songs payed great homage to the originals and Jasmines new song reminded me a lot of "How Far I'll Go" in Moana (that was a very good thing).

And Will Smith....before his arrival in the film I was already looking at my watch cause I was not liking anything I saw. BUT...kept telling myself wait until Genie shows.....and I'll be damned if will Smith, who was playing arguably the hardest role in this film was the person that brought it all together!

Immediately the chemistry between him and Aladdin is believable (and it only gets better)! Immediately the conflict between Aladdin and Jasmine has some weight! I loved every scene he was in!

Changes! Some of the changes were for the better. Giving Jasmine a handmaiden was great and her character felt like she belonged. The Genie not caring about being free and trying to convince Aladdin to use his third wish was an interesting change that I thought fit.

But overall.....still give it a pass. Everything leading up to Will Smith was awful and whenevers he's not on screen I'm left wondering where he is cause I don't like what's left. Jafar is horrible and probably the biggest let down as he's such a classic villain from Disney. Hell this guy should have been the easiest character to cast and could have had a lot of fun with his portrayal.

It's worth a watch just for Will Smith....but can easily wait until it's out of theaters.
